Agenda

  1. Is it possible to provide more info regarding develop -> redermetadata since some of these are really handy to evaluate mesh object and to have a better understanding of the complete picture [Zed Tremont]
  2. We know that the highest o the calculation values in the uploader is what sets the LI. If the physics is the highest contributor, that can be fixed with a custom physics mesh. What, specifically, should we be looking to do to our model that effects "Download" and what effects "Server", so we know the difference, in more laymen like terms, and how we can lower LI through changing the model to affect Download or Server values? [Eleanora Newell]
  3. Is it on purpose that the exact values of the default Avatar can not be reached with the SL shape editor ? i.e.: When i set a default value to itself with a slider, then the new (true) floating point value sometimes differs slightly from the default. This makes trouble with external tools, because it is not clear how to support this in a meaningful way. Is there any chance for a fix such that all default values can be set by the SL sliders ? [Gaia Clary]
